BirlaSoft
BirlaSoft2h ago
Indeed

Technical Specialist

Hyderabad, Telangana
Full Time
Senior Level

Auto Apply to 50+ AI Matched Technical Specialist Jobs

Use Auto Apply Agents to Bulk Apply jobs with ATS Optimised Resumes, find verified Insider Connections for jobs at BirlaSoft

Full Job Description

Technical Specialist - App Development

BirlaSoft is seeking a Senior Front-end Developer with a specialization in React JS to join their team in Hyderabad, Telangana. This role is responsible for independently developing a web-based application from requirements and wireframe designs.

Responsibilities:

  • Minimum 5 years of React Development experience with strong proficiency in front-end frameworks like React JS.
  • Translate requirements and wireframes into low-level and high-level application system designs, including diagrams for application flow, ports, protocols, communication strategies, and microservices identification.
  • Define and enforce coding best practices, secure coding standards, and other team guidelines.
  • Conduct thorough code reviews to identify anomalies.
  • Extensive use of JavaScript, React JS, Node JS, Bootstrap, jQuery/AJAX, JSON, HTML4/5, and CSS2/3 for building interactive User Interfaces (UI).
  • Assist the team in working with Lifecycle Methods, State, Props, and Events to create interactive and stateful React Components, and implement routing using react-router.
  • Define and implement communication strategies between React Components, including class-based and function-based components.
  • Participate in the design and development of Restful APIs and services for data layer interaction.
  • Identify and implement reusable React components and functions for future use.
  • Extensive experience in developing Restful web services using Express and NodeJS.
  • Strong knowledge of MongoDB, including experience with Mongoose, writing aggregation commands, index creation, and optimal schema design for document-based databases.
  • Write Lambda functions, schedule and monitor AWS batch jobs, and monitor AWS CloudWatch, escalating issues as needed.
  • Build and manage CI/CD pipelines using AWS pipelines, defining application deployment strategies and best practices within an AWS environment.
  • Minimum of 4+ years of strong UI development experience using React JS, with robust JavaScript (OOJS) skills.
  • Experience in developing web-based UIs and Single Page Applications (SPAs).
  • Strong knowledge of HTML, CSS, SCSS, SASS, Responsive Web Design (RWD), JavaScript, and jQuery.
  • Solid understanding of Object-Oriented Programming (OOP) concepts.
  • Experience with testing tools such as Jest, Detox, Cypress, etc.
  • Familiarity with popular React.js workflows (e.g., Flux, Redux, Mobx).
  • Responsible for developing responsive front-end UI designs in React, integrating with backend Spring Boot services.
  • Experience working with web services (REST APIs, SOAP, APIs).
  • Maintain a clean coding style with clear separation of UI and functionality.
  • Collaborate effectively with back-end developers for user-facing element integration.
  • Perform UI tests to optimize application performance.
  • Familiarity with Micro frontend architecture and design patterns.
  • Familiarity with Agile development methodologies.

Skills:

  • Mandatory: CSS (PL3), REST API's (PL3), HTML 5.0 (PL3), JavaScript (PL3)
  • Optional: TypeScript (PL2), Bootstrap 5 (PL2), JSP (PL2), Vue JS (PL2), Webpack (PL2)
  • Functional Skills: Programming/Software Development (PL3), Software Design (PL2), Software Configuration (PL3), Test Execution (PL2), Knowledge Management (PL2), Requirements Definition And Management (PL1), Estimation & Scheduling (PL1), Stakeholder Relationship Management (PL1)
  • Behavioral Skills: Help the tribe (PL2), Think Holistically (PL2), Win the Customer (PL2), One Birlasoft (PL2), Results Matter (PL2), Get Future Ready (PL2)
  • Other: Team Management (PL1), Quality Assurance (PL1)

Company

BirlaSoft

BirlaSoft

Hyderabad, Telangana
Posted on Indeed